"Who is this beauty?" Mama Grace complimented of the little girl in her son's lap over FaceTime.

Waving her small hand, the shy child gave a silent hello.

"Ma, this is Gracianna. Your granddaughter."  Spencer ripped the bandaid off, causing his mother to choke on her afternoon cup of tea.

Little Cici giggled at the result of her Dad's late reveal of her existence.

"....My....what?" Mama Grace coughed, needing to hear the statement again, in case she heard incorrectly.

"She's my daughter, Ma." Spencer rephrased.

"Which one of these fast little groupies have you knocked up, boy!" His mother immediately went into scolding mode, causing Cici to cover her ears in shock.

Widening his eyes, he instinctivly jerked back from the phone, as if his mom could reach through the screen and smack him silly. Scared by his mother's obvious anger towards his hypothetical indecency, Spencer reverted into a childish natural, immediately needing to explain his actions.

"It's not what you think, Ma. I didn't hook up with no random. She's mine and Liv's little girl." Spencer informed an upset Mama Grace, hoping to lighten her mood. "Olivia was pregnant when we broke up. I just found out myself this morning."

"What are you talking about, Spencer?" Mama Grace gasped, stunned by the turn of events. "Are you saying she hid my grand baby from you? Olivia wouldn't do that. Not Billy's girl."

"I don't know why she did it. I haven't gotten in touch with her yet." Spencer detailed,"I thought I'd introduce yall first, then deal with Olivia afterward." He added, stroking Gracianna's curls.

"Her name...." Mama Grace teared up, gazing at her apparent granddaughter. "She's umm...."

"Yeah, Ma. She's named after you." Spencer grinned as his mom cried lightly at the news. "Olivia named her after you and Pops. Tell your grandma your full name, Ci." He insisted gently, giving his daughter a comforting pat on the back.

"Grac..ianna... Cori...lynn...James." She mumbled, still getting used to the idea of her grandmother whom she'd heard of but never met.

Unable to resist, Mama Grace let more tears flow, processing her granddaughter's namesake.

"That's a beautiful name for a precious little girl." Mama Grace complimented once more.

"Thanks, Nana." Cici giggled again, amused by how easily her grandmother cried. "I've also wanted to meet you. Mama says I got most of my brains from you and Lolo."

"Who's Lolo?" Mama Grace laughed at the nickname.

"Olivia's mom. That's what she calls her."

"Uh, huh. Lolo is married to Papa Bi." Cici agreed with her father, adding Billy Baker to the mix.

"So Billy and Laura knew about her and didn't bother to let either of us know. Unbelievable." Mama Grace snapped towards no one in particular.

"Baby girl, let me speak to your Nana real quick." Spencer whispered into Cici's ear, kissing the side of her head.

"Ok." Gracianna nodded, hopping off of Spencer's lap, "Nice to finally meet you, Nana."

"You too, pretty girl. I will speak to you more after your daddy and I talk." Mama Grace promised as the little smiled before trotting off.

Once she was at a good distance, Mama Grace became frank. "Who do they think they are keeping a whole child from her own family?! If Olivia hadn't decided to come clean, I would have missed the entire life of my only grandbaby." She fumed.
